## Relevance tuning: Lanternquery

When click-through on top-3 results drops below baseline, check the boost weights first. Recent tuning moved title-match boosts down and recency up after the Harwick report. Re-run the offline judgment set before shipping any weight change. The current production weights for the ranking service are as follows.

settings of fafog-haduf:
ZORIX_PIN=4648
ZORIX_METRICS_HOST=metrics.zorix.paliqsys.corp
ZORIX_LOG_LEVEL=info
ZORIX_TENANT=druix

TURN-208: Gatevale turnstile counters at the Merrow Field pilot double-count when a rotation reverses mid-cycle. Attendance totals drift roughly 2% high per event. The debounce window fix is implemented, reviewed by Ilsa, and soak-tested across two simulated match days without drift. Ready for your cut; the candidate build is identified below.

trace token, tagag-tafog: htk6_5ed18c

Subject: Queuewright cut-over complete — log compaction enabled

Team,

The cut-over of the Queuewright broker cluster finished last night without incident. Log compaction is now active on all keyed topics, replacing the old time-based retention. Compacted segments are verified hourly by the Tallgrass audit job, and tombstone retention matches our deletion-request SLA. No consumer lag anomalies were observed during the switch. For your security review, the relevant broker settings as deployed are listed below.

config for tawif-bagef:
[sorwyn]
team = sorys
access_code = ac_9ba40c
host = sorwyn.ordingrid.local
port = 5000
owner = aldok.quenion
peer = belath.paliqcloud.local